-.Sh NAME
-.Nm ext2fs
-.Nd "ext2/ext3/ext4 file system"
-.Sh SYNOPSIS
-To link into the kernel:
-.Bd -ragged -offset indent
-.Cd "options EXT2FS"
-.Ed
-.Pp
-To load as a kernel loadable module:
-.Pp
-.Dl "kldload ext2fs"
-.Sh DESCRIPTION
-The
-.Nm
-driver will permit the
-.Fx
-kernel to access
-ext2
-file systems and its derivatives.
-It currently implements most of the features required by
-.Em ext3
-and
-.Em ext4
-file systems.
-Support for Extended Attributes in
-.Em ext4
-is experimental.
-Journalling and encryption are currently not supported.
-.Sh EXAMPLES
-To mount a
-.Nm
-volume located on
-.Pa /dev/ada1s1 :
-.Pp
-.Dl "mount -t ext2fs /dev/ada1s1 /mnt"

-.Sh HISTORY
-The
-.Nm
-driver first appeared in
-.Fx 2.2 .
-.Sh AUTHORS
-.An -nosplit
-The
-.Nm
-kernel implementation is derived from code written,
-or modified,
-by
-.An Godmar Back
-using the UFS CSRG sources for CMU Mach.
-.Pp
-.An John Dyson
-did the initial port to
-.Fx .
-.An Aditya Sarawgi
-merged important parts of the allocation code from a clean-room
-.Nx
-implementation.
-.An Zheng Liu
-and
-.An Fedor Uporov
-implemented the read and write support respectively for
-.Em ext4
-filesystems.
-The
-.Fx
-community has contributed a huge amount of modifications.
